This course introduces participants to programme using Visual Basic for Applications (VBA). We don't assume any prior programming background. Essentially candidates will learn how to create distributed scalable Access applications.

A two day intensive course. The course assumes no prior Access knowledge but takes candidates to the point where they can build, manage and query an Access based relational database.
